Well, here it is : DarkSide501st's Iron Man Mark VII JFcustomized files.

Note that Boots, gloves, brace, collar, collar plate, and neck are missing. You can pick them up from Robo3687'MK4 JFcustomized foam pep release.

I'll join a readme file soon, because I think that some tips need to be explain before you drive straight against the wall. For exemple, in the abs file, each flat part that is normaly on the front side of the body (as shown on 3D view) must here in fact be glued on the back side, between each pair of ribs, behind the corresponding vertebra. Front side is left opened, covered by the four abs plates.
A few little tricks like that, not explicit on the pep view.

Joining articulated and some sealed parts :

I used to work as graphist in a publicity agency, and we had always somewhere in the office a couple of useless and sun-faded color charts.



And ?

And I kept thinking that the potential of these pretty little plastic juncture clips were heavyly underexploited.



So I ordered a pack of 100 pieces, as it almost doesn't costs anything.




You can find some here or here or here or here... of various shape, color, diameter and thickness.





And I promise you some discret and incredibly easy attaching for mobile parts (knees elbow toes...) as well as sealed parts such top chest, flaps, handplates, spin and so on... depending of the pressure when cliping.
